Complementary means first and foremost complementary. With color tones there is always a direct complementary color that is exactly opposite to the other.

With this color tone #980EA4 it is the complementary color #67F15B. Both colors form the strongest contrast to each other and are especially recommended for use in direct connection with each other.

Warmer colors are created when the hue is shifted towards red, orange and yellow. These colors convey warmth, energy and an inviting atmosphere.

The following warmer shades match the #980EA4 shade: #980EA4, #A40E87, #A40E5F, #A40E36 and #A40E0E

They are stimulating and dynamic and are often used to attract attention or create a friendly and lively mood. An example of this transition is a shift from a cool blue through purple to red and orange.

Colder colors are created by shifting the hue towards green, blue and violet.

The following colder shades match the #980EA4 shade: #980EA4, #6F0EA4, #470EA4, #1E0EA4 and #0E0EA4

These colors have a cool, calming effect and create distance. They are often used to convey a sense of calm, freshness and stability. A classic example of this color range is a gradient from yellow to green to a deep blue or violet, reminiscent of water and sky.

The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

The following analogous shades match the #980EA4 shade: #470EA4, #6F0EA4, #970EA4, #A40E88 and #A40E60

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The following triaden shades match the #980EA4 shade: #980EA4, #A4970E and #0EA497

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

The following tetraden shades match the #980EA4 shade: #980EA4, #A41F0E, #1AA40E and #0E92A4

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

This color makes magenta stand out from the other colors. The values representing the red and blue hue are greater than the third value. They are close together and exceed the value of the green hue. Since the color values are relatively low compared to others, this hue appears darker to us.

The breakdown of the color into the RGB color system: of 255 maximum color components, 152 red, 14 green and 164 blue.
